Yes, Beats Studio 3 pads can be replaced. This is a practical option for maintaining your headphones in prime condition without having to replace the entire unit. Replacement ear pads are available from various retailers, both official and third-party suppliers. Look for pads specifically designed for Beats Studio 3 to ensure a perfect fit and comfort. Changing the ear pads can be done at home and usually requires no special tools. For the best results, refer to a guide or video tutorial to ensure you replace them properly and safely.

  1. Are Beats Studio 3 ear pads compatible with other Beats models? Beats Studio 3 ear pads are specifically designed for that model to ensure the best fit and comfort, and may not be fully compatible with other Beats headphone models.
  2. How often should I replace the ear pads on my Beats Studio 3 headphones? It’s recommended to replace ear pads when they show signs of wear, such as cracking, discomfort, or loss of cushioning, typically every 1-2 years depending on usage.
  3. Can I replace Beats Studio 3 ear pads at home without special tools? Yes, Beats Studio 3 ear pads can typically be replaced at home without special tools by carefully following tutorials to avoid damage.
